'82 300D done today.  That was fun and easy, even on dirt!  Problem #1 was getting the 
oil pressure sensor line loose.  Even with an oil wrench, I couldn't get the fitting to 
break loose and ended up taking the piece off the back of the oil filter canister.  
Problem #2 was getting the transmission cord loose.  Ended up breaking one of the plastic 
tabs off of the connector before I got it out.  Hrm..not too bad for my first pull.  So, 
with the engine out, we could easily look at the hole in the block (mostly the top of the 
oil pan) that is on both sides.  It's about 4"x3" at the #1 rod on both sides.
